Comprehending the Role of Automotive Key Locksmiths
Automotive key locksmiths concentrate on dealing with vehicle locks and keys. Their competence encompasses a series of services, including key duplication, lock repair, and the programming of electronic keys. As cars have become more technologically advanced, the skills required for locksmiths have developed, making their services important for vehicle owners.
Key Services Provided by Automotive Key Locksmiths
| Service | Description |
|---|---|
| Key Duplication | Making an additional copy of a key. |
| Key Replacement | Changing lost or broken keys, including transponder and wise keys. |
| Lockout Services | Helping individuals locked out of their automobiles. |
| Ignition Repair/Replacement | Repairing or replacing damaged ignition systems. |
| Key Programming | Programming transponder and remote keys to sync with the vehicle's system. |
| Lock Repair/Replacement | Repairing or replacing faulty locks. |
| Emergency Services | 24/7 assistance for urgent situations. |

The Process of Working with an Automotive Key Locksmith
When engaging the services of an automotive locksmith, comprehending the procedure can cause a smoother experience. Here's what to anticipate:
Initial Assessment: The locksmith will examine the situation, such as whether you've lost your key or are experiencing ignition issues.
Identification: To ensure security, the locksmith will generally ask for evidence of ownership, such as a vehicle registration or recognition.
Service Recommendation: After the evaluation, the locksmith will recommend the very best course of action, whether it's key duplication, lock replacement, or programming a new key.
Execution of Service: The locksmith will perform the essential work, which may include producing a new key, fixing a lock, or reprogramming an electronic key.
Evaluating: Once the work is completed, the locksmith typically checks the new key or lock to guarantee it operates properly.
Payment and Receipt: Finally, payment is accepted, and a receipt is offered for the service rendered.
Kinds Of Automotive Keys
Automotive keys have actually developed throughout the years, and understanding the types available can be useful for car owners.
Key Types Overview
| Key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Traditional Keys | Standard metal keys that run basic lock systems. |
| Transponder Keys | Keys with a chip that interacts with the vehicle's immobilizer for added security. |
| Smart Keys | Key fobs that utilize proximity sensors; they enable the owner to unlock and start the car without inserting the key. |
| Remote Keys | Keys that feature a push-button control feature, allowing users to lock/unlock the vehicle from a distance. |
FAQs About Automotive Key Locksmiths
1. What should I do if I lose my car keys?
Contact an automotive locksmith right away. They can supply services to develop a new key or gain access to your vehicle.
2. Can locksmiths program clever keys?
Yes, a lot of automotive locksmiths are trained to program clever keys and transponder keys to sync with your vehicle's systems.
3. For how long does it take to make a new key?
The time varies depending upon the key type and vehicle model. Typically, it can take anywhere from 20 minutes to an hour.
4. Are locksmith services costly?
Expenses can vary commonly depending on the service needed, the kind of key, and the vehicle make/model. Typically, locksmiths use more competitive rates than car dealerships.
